The architect
Annemieke Koopmans-Holtrop is an architect with a deep fascination for the tactile and sensory qualities of materials.
As founder and lead designer at flokk & fjell, she brings together technical precision and artistic sensitivity , creating textile acoustic solutions that are as functional as they are poetic.
With a background rooted in both construction and composition, Annemieke approaches wool with the architect’s eye for space, lines, and relationships. She allows the material’s natural qualities color, fiber, texture to guide each design rather than control it.
Her inspiration comes from the Norwegian landscape, traditional building techniques, and a respect for the timeless. The result is handcrafted products defined by quiet luxury, made for interiors that value both stillness and character.
